Description
Deliciously vibrant crumb bars featuring sweet strawberries and tangy rhubarb, perfect for any occasion.
Ingredients
Scale
- 2 cups chopped strawberries
- 2 cups chopped rhubarb
- 3/4 cup granulated sugar
- 2 tbsp cornstarch
- 1 tbsp lemon juice
- 2 1/2 cups all-purpose flour
- 1 cup rolled oats
- 1 cup brown sugar
- 1 tsp ground cinnamon
- 1 tsp baking powder
- 1/4 tsp salt
- 1 cup unsalted butter, cold and cubed
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C). Prepare a 9×13-inch baking pan by greasing it lightly or lining it with parchment paper for easy removal later.
- Combine the chopped strawberries, rhubarb, granulated sugar, cornstarch, and lemon juice in a mixing bowl. Toss everything together until the fruit is well-coated. Set this aside.
- Whisk together the all-purpose flour, rolled oats, brown sugar, ground cinnamon, baking powder, and salt in a separate bowl.
- Cut the cold, cubed butter into the dry ingredients using a pastry cutter or fork until you achieve a coarse, crumbly texture.
- Press about two-thirds of the crumb mixture firmly into the bottom of the prepared pan to form your crust.
- Spread the strawberry-rhubarb filling evenly over the crust.
- Sprinkle the remaining crumb mixture over the top of the fruit filling.
- Bake for 40-45 minutes, until the topping is golden brown and the filling bubbles.
- Cool completely in the pan before slicing into bars.
Notes
For best flavor, prepare the bars a day in advance and allow them to sit overnight in the fridge.
